zerct

Python CLI package for deploying Rust backends and static frontends to Zerct.

pipx install zerct
zerct init my-app --template fullstack-rust-tanstack
cd my-app/web && bun install && cd ..
zerct doctor --json
zerct preview
zerct deploy --wait --json

From a full-stack repo root, zerct deploy discovers nested zerct.toml files and deploys the whole workspace in one command.

Rust backend deploys require cargo fmt --all --check, locked cargo check, and locked all-target, all-feature Clippy with -D warnings.

Static frontend deploys require TypeScript browser source, tsgo --noEmit for typecheck, and native linting such as oxlint, biome check, or deno lint.

Agent repair loop:

zerct doctor --json
zerct deploy --wait --json
zerct logs --build job_1 --json

Fix the first failed agent_instruction. If a build fails, inspect build logs, fix the first actionable log error, rerun doctor, then redeploy.

On first deploy, the CLI opens browser login, waits for GitHub or Google, stores the Zerct session in the OS credential store when available, and continues the deploy. Later commands reuse that session.
